Невозможно открыть драйвер Gecko с пакетом RSelenium в R без использования Docker - PullRequest
0 голосов
/ 12 февраля 2019

Я не могу подключиться к серверу Selenium.

Я использую RSelenium для автоматизации сбора данных для школьного проекта.Меня сбивает с толку то, что он работает каждый день в течение двух недель, но я перезапустил свой MacBook, поэтому мне пришлось переподключиться к серверу Selenium, и теперь я не могу заставить его работать.Я попытался переустановить Firefox, Geckodriver, автономный сервер Selen, и попытался запустить его с Chrome.

Я положил это в терминал: java -jar /Users/x/data/selenium-server-standalone-3.141.59.jar -port 5556

Это то, что я делаю в R: remDr <- RSelenium::remoteDriver(extraCapabilities = list(marionette = TRUE), port=5556) remDr$open()

Я получаю это сообщение об ошибке при запуске remDr$Open():

Сообщение Selenium: не удалось создать новый сервис: GeckoDriverService Информация о сборке: версия: '3.141.59', ревизия: 'e82be7d358', время: '2018-11-14T08: 25: 53'Системная информация: хост:' MacBook-Pro-3.local ', ip:' [удалена конфиденциальная информация] ', os.name:' Mac OS X ', os.arch:' x86_64 ', os.version: '10 .14.3 ', java.version: '11 .0.2' Информация о драйвере: driver.version: неизвестно

Ошибка: сводка: SessionNotCreatedException Подробности: не удалось создать новый сеанс.Дополнительные сведения: запустите метод errorDetails

Я могу запустить его с помощью Docker и Tight VNC, но, к сожалению, это приводит к большому количеству ошибок, так как мне нужно использовать отладочную версию для сбора данных.

1 Ответ

0 голосов
/ 12 февраля 2019

Хммм никогда не видел такого типа ошибки раньше.@jdharrison ты можешь посмотреть на это?

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...